Sump Pump Overflow Water Removal Cost in Surfside, CA

The cost of sump pump overflow water removal in Surfside, CA can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ate and work with you to develop a plan that meets your needs and budget. Our goal is to get your home back to normal as quickly and affordably as possible. We’ll work with your insurance provider to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Water Removal and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of equipment needed, and complexity of the job.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and complexity of the job.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and complexity of the job.
Repairs and Restoration $500 – $2,500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
